Socks
 
I was wondering which under sock would be better for wicking away moisture. I was looking at Cabela's and they have both a polypropylene and dacron polyester socks. Which do you think would do the best job?

okcmco 12-07-2005 10:42 PM

RE: Socks
 
I like the polypro. The udersock does another cool thing. The 2 socks help avoid blisters. The rubbing that happens from walking occur between the 2 socks and not between the sock and your feet
